FROM POLICE OFFICER TO EDUCATOR
Michael Bascombe
 Assistant Principal, Adrian Peters DALLAS, Texas, August 27, 2010: A young Grenadian has embarked on an educational journey and in the process accomplished many feats.
Adrian Peters, a former police officer, left Grenada in January 2004 to
complete a first degree in Foreign Languages at Midwestern State
University (MSU) in the United States and, six years later, he is about
to start the journey towards a doctoral degree.
Peters began studies at the University of Ciego de Avila and then the
University of Havana, Cuba in Interpretation and Translation in 1999 and
then moved to MSU in January 2004 to complete a Bachelor Degree in
Foreign Languages, majoring in Spanish and French. He graduated with
honours one year later.

OPPOSITION LEADER TO MEET WITH DIASPORA IN THE UNITED STATES AND CANADA
 Dr. Keith Mitchell St. George, August 27, 2010: Leader of Her Majesty’s Opposition, The Hon. Dr. Keith C. Mitchell, left the island on Wednesday August 25, 2010 to visit the United States and Canada for a series of meetings with the Diaspora community.
Doctor Mitchell is expected to update Grenadians and friends of Grenada
residing in those communities on the present situation in Grenada under
the Tillman Thomas administration. He will also provide information to
them relating to the hardships presently encountered by the people of
the Grenada.
There will also be a number of fundraising activities which will be held in honor of the Opposition Leader.

GRENADA TO IMPORT BANANAS FROM ST. VINCENT
ST GEORGE’S, Grenada, CMC, August 24, 2010 – Grenada has resumed the importation of bananas from neighbouring St. Vincent and the Grenadines after a prolonged drought season seriously affected banana cultivation, officials said.
